I posted about this here the night it happened, but a few years ago here in Texas, we had a MASSIVE ice storm by our standards that shut down the entire city. All power was out All streets were empty All pets were inside & all the feral critters were buckled down. All the insects were dead or dormant & there was no wind, no traffic, & no urban white noise whatsoever. NONE AT ALL. Period. The city was utterly & completely dead. The only sound I could hear was the voice in my head & it wasn't until that night that I truly realized for the first time in my life what silence sounded like.

It was simultaneously the most beautiful & terrifying thing that I''ve never heard.

...I simply have no other words that can explain how that actually felt.
